1

Observe Tanzania's Wildlife Wonders

News Discuss 
Tanzania, the land of breathtaking vistas, is a haven for wildlife enthusiasts. Here, you can observe some of Africa's most famous creatures in their untamed habitats. Imagine yourself exploring the vast plains, https://chiarabacg515744.blog2freedom.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story